    Job responsibilities:

    • Responsible for daily funding and liquidity risk management for the Mumbai Branch and related entities, including local currency, USD, and other active currency nostros.

    • Responsible for collateral and reserve management, including purchasing Government/Corporate securities for settlement and regulatory compliance.

    • Managing positions within assigned limits, including BPV and liquidity profile.

    • Executing funding trades such as money markets, repo/reverse repo, and FX with internal and external counterparties.

    • Responsible for daily pricing and submission of transfer pricing rates for loans and deposits and daily P&L estimation and reporting.

    • Preparing and reviewing liquidity-related reports, including collateral reports, stress tests, and daily market commentary.

    • Participating in front-office projects such as balance sheet analysis, quarterly Structural Interest Rate Risk (SIRR) review, and FX quarterly write-up.

    • Collaborating with internal functions including Funds Transfer Pricing & Liquidity Management Team, Liquidity Risk Oversight, Middle Office, Risk, Finance, and Business Management teams.

    • Liaising with interbank counterparties and other branch stakeholders such as CIB businesses, LEC, and local compliance.
